Austin Business Pulse
- Culture Innovation-focused, casual, and energetic. The "Silicon Hills" values speed and creativity.
- Lunch Break 12:30 PM - 1:30 PM.
- Pro Tip Ideal call window is 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M. Expect a casual-professional vibe (lots of tech-casual wear). Technical competence and speed are highly valued. Central Time makes it easy to sync with both US coasts. Networking is a major part of the local business culture.
Turin Business Pulse
- Culture Industrial, formal, and values precision. Home to major manufacturing and design.
- Lunch Break 1:00 PM - 2:00 PM.
- Pro Tip Best times for calls are 9:30 AM to 11:30 AM. Business culture in Turin is formal and organized, reflecting its industrial heritage. Be well-prepared and organized. Punctuality is highly valued. Maintain a professional and steady tone throughout your communications.
